Just-A-Start is a non-profit community development corporation with tax-exempt charitable status. Our programs focus on:
- Training & Human Development
- Stabilizing Occupied Housing & Preventing
Homelessness
- Developing & Retaining Affordable Housing
- Community Building & Economic Development

| Since,
1968, Just-A-Start Corporation (JAS) has been enabling working and
retired families in Cambridge and surrounding Metro North communities
to meet basic family needs. JAS provides services to homeowners
and renters to help increase their quality of living; offers education
and workforce training opportunities that enhance career prospects and
earning power; and develops, rehabilitates and preserves sorely needed,
affordable rental and ownership housing. Just-A-Start works with
individuals, families and groups in addressing these needs and enables
people to participate fully in the life of their community. |

On June 7, at the Just A Start Annual Meeting, Gordon Gottsche, founder and Executive Director of Just A Start for more than 40 years, announced his intent to retire this year.
The Board of Directors expressed its deep appreciation for his seminal and lasting contributions to the organization and to the City of Cambridge and surrounding communities during his many years of dedicated and inspired service.
